Prepared for the incoming director, Halverton Consumer Group. The proposed 18% reduction to the marketing budget affects primarily the Brightmoor campaign and regional sponsorships; digital acquisition spend is protected. We modelled three scenarios, and the middle case preserves lead volume at roughly 91% of current levels. The team is understandably anxious, so sequencing of the announcement matters. Procurement commitments through Q2 are already locked. The reduction connects directly to a broader plan, summarised below for your review.

confidential, yagag-tajof: Only 3 of the 120 pilot accounts renewed Holwyn, so a churn review is set for April 15.

The nightly job verifying sort stability in the Reportsmith builder has been failing since Tuesday. Multi-column sorts are reordering equal-rank rows between runs, which breaks snapshot diffs. We can't confirm whether this is a genuine stability regression or stale fixtures, because the validation job's credentials for the internal Ledgergate comparison service expired last week. A fresh key was provisioned this morning and needs to go into the job's vault entry. The replacement key follows.

app token of yajeg-kawef = kto11_7En3XSX8xQw

## Deploying the Gatewick Proctor Queue

Deploys are pretty painless: push to main, wait for the pipeline, then watch the queue drain dashboard for five minutes. If candidates pile up mid-exam, roll back first and ask questions later — the queue replays safely. Everything the workers care about lives in one config block, shown here for reference.

settings of bafof-yagef:
JOROX_PIN=8740
JOROX_TENANT=pelox
JOROX_METRICS_HOST=metrics.jorox.qorvelworks.internal
JOROX_SEAL=seal_c78f63c1
JOROX_STANDBY_TEAM=norax